What Employers and Hiring Managers Look for When Recruiting Architects
Summary
Stephen Drew explains what employers and hiring managers look for when recruiting architects, including how to stand out, what skills matter, and how to improve CVs, portfolios and application emails.The best applications make it easy for a hiring manager to understand the person, the evidence and the fit quickly.
Stephen Drew explains what employers and hiring managers look for when recruiting architects, including how to stand out, what skills matter, and how to improve CVs, portfolios and application emails.
The conversation covers:
- How to stand out in a competitive architecture job market
- Which skills employers tend to look for first
- How to make a CV easier to review
- What a strong portfolio needs to communicate
- How to write an application email that gets attention
